ENGLISH PROFICIENCY TEST

As you know already, English language is among Canada’s list of official languages(French being the other official language).

Mind you, IELTS(The International English Language System) is not a necessity anymore. However, you still need to take an English test – Such as, TOEFL, Duolingo and English Proficiency Certificates from your previous academic institutions.

STEP ONE: APPLY FOR A STUDENT PERMIT

This is a special piece of document that allows international students, like you, to study at designated learning institutions(like Canadian Universities).

 

STEP TWO: GATHER ALL OTHER DOCUMENTS YOU MAY NEED

Even for local universities, there are certain documents you will be required to have at hand. This includes passport photographs(numerous), identity card, custodian declaration, letter of explanation, and many more.

 

STEP THREE: GET ACCEPTANCE LETTER

Without an acceptance letter, everything you will be doing is going to count as futile. So what you should do is obtain an acceptance letter from the Canadian uni of your choice.
